Answer:

KL = 8

Step-by-step explanation:

Based on the midsegment theorem, the length of midsegment KL = ½ of the length of the third segment FH.

Thus:

KL = ½(FH)

FH = 16

Plug in the value into the equation

KL = ½(16)

KL = 8
